1. Guided Historical Tour

Take a step back in time with a guided historical tour of the Kish Albanian Church, a Caucasian Albanian church located in the mountainous city of Sheki, Azerbaijan. The church is an architectural marvel and important cultural heritage site that dates back to the first century, though the current structure was largely rebuilt in the 12th century. Visitors will be captivated by its ancient stone construction and the surrounding cemetery with its early Christian gravestones. The tour delves into the history of the Caucasian Albanian people, the spread of Christianity in the region, and the church's unique architectural features, including the frescoes and inscriptions inside. Gain insights into the centuries-old traditions and legends associated with this enchanting place.
